            @bhepler

            osmMapUrl: "https://cartodb-basemaps-{s}.global.ssl.fastly.net/dark_all/{z}/{x}/{y}.png"
            

            I’m using the dark map referenced above on a black background but every time the module changes zoom level it fills with a white background until the new map tiles populate. It’s worst when zooming out,
            Does anyone know if it there is a parameter I can change so the blank tiles between zoom levels stay black?

            This is a minor annoyance with an otherwise great module.
            Thank you!

            J 1 Reply Last reply Feb 3, 2022, 7:01 AM Reply Quote 0
            • J Offline
              Jalibu Module Developer @fmarcu
              last edited by Feb 3, 2022, 7:01 AM

              @fmarcu said in MMM-RAIN-MAP (new: version 2.x):

              Does anyone know if it there is a parameter I can change so the blank tiles between zoom levels stay black?

              try to add this to your custom.css

              .MMM-RAIN-MAP .leaflet-container {
                background: #000;
              }

                    @karsten13 Unfortunately, I can’t tell you that. I am only responsible for the display layer, not for the weather data :-)
                    The radar layers come from the Rainviewer API, which I have actually had quite good experiences with in the past.
                    Is it the usual case on your mirror that the displayed radar images do not match the reality?

                    What I can see is that RegenRadar.de and RainViewer have different scales. With RainViewer it needs a much higher degree of cloudiness to be displayed on the map.
